## Runbook: Ledgerhatch Schema Registry

A few things future-you will want to know. Ledgerhatch validates every event schema on publish, and rejects backward-incompatible changes by default — don't disable that check, even under pressure. If producers are blocked, the right move is usually a new schema version, not a force-push. The registry caches aggressively, so changes can take a minute to propagate; be patient before paging anyone. The settings the registry currently runs with are below.

deployment values, tawip-hawif:
[briax]
host = briax.zemvarsys.internal
user = briax_svc
database = briax_prod

Vendor note for new team members: canary gating on the Bramblewick platform is enforced by our vendor, Opaline Systems, not by us. Their Gatewright tool holds each canary at 5% traffic until error rate, latency p95, and saturation all pass for 30 minutes. We cannot override the hold; only Opaline's release desk can. Document any gating dispute in the vendor log before requesting an exception. For exception requests, write to their release desk directly.

alerts address for bahaf-kaduf: zorox@qorvelio.internal

Handover: Tilecrane prefetcher, quick notes. It warms map tiles for the Norwick viewer ahead of peak hours. Queue drains fine; the flaky part is the zoom-level cap — if memory climbs past 70%, the cap auto-lowers and doesn't recover until restart. Known issue, ticket open. Don't touch the eviction logic; it's tuned. Deploys go through the standard pipeline, nothing special. Restart is safe anytime outside 06:00–09:00 local. Ping Osric with questions after I'm out. The service's current configuration values are listed below.

config for bagep-kageg:
ULADOR_LOG_LEVEL=warn
ULADOR_METRICS_HOST=metrics.ulador.tolvaqcorp.corp
ULADOR_POOL_SIZE=32

Team,

Quick summary for the sync: the Fernwhistle bounce processor cut-over finished Tuesday night. All inbound NDRs now route through the new parser, and the legacy queue drained cleanly by morning. Bounce classification accuracy looks consistent with staging numbers. One retry-loop hiccup was patched before go-live. The production configuration we landed on is shown below.

settings of fafog-haduf:
ZORIX_PIN=4648
ZORIX_METRICS_HOST=metrics.zorix.paliqsys.corp
ZORIX_LOG_LEVEL=info
ZORIX_TENANT=druix